Output 20523383cf82b94d85815ed8f9886eebeae69c95221665020bb8d59dfb912e55:68

value
25878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3737ed24ddd329ebf551d06938fb160598ecb45e OP_EQUAL
address
36iz5vbfxiXfWFK7rMRrRx5vitMP7XHJ7b
transaction
20523383cf82b94d85815ed8f9886eebeae69c95221665020bb8d59dfb912e55